WebHere’s a look at mintages and values for 1934 Mercury dimes: 1934, 24,080,000 minted; $6 1934-D, 6,772,000; $9 * Values are for coins grading Extremely Fine-40. Both the 1934 and 1934-D Mercury dimes are easily obtainable not … WebAny Mercury dimes engraved with the years 1932 or 1933 are fake. From 1929 to 1933, the U.S. Mint also cut production of silver dollars, and during the years of 1930, 1931, 1932, and 1933, there were no half dollars struck nor were there quarters minted in 1931 and 1933.
